ISI ResearchSoft Upgrades Reference Manager
Thomson ISI ResearchSoft has shipped a major upgrade to Reference Manager (http://www.refman.com), its bibliographic software that streamlines research, writing, and publishing for corporate, government, and academic researchers. The new Reference Manager 11 delivers new ways to view and share reference collections—publish Reference Manager databases on the Web, create subject bibliographies instantly, exchange references with colleagues, connect to data visualization tools in one step, and support workgroups with new network utilities.Users can quickly post up to 15 Reference Manager databases to the Web or to an intranet with Reference Manager's built-in Web server and simple Web publishing tool. Colleagues can access the Web publisher site to search, add, edit, and export references in RIS and XML formats. Reference Manager 11 databases can also be accessed by third-party applications and enterprise portals using SOAP and WSDL standards. Users can capture references directly from colleagues' Microsoft Word papers with the export traveling library feature. Reference Manager 11 can also import and export files in XML format enabling use with other applications. Users can move references between Reference Manager 11 and data visualization tools, such as RefViz by ISI ResearchSoft, in one step to explore research literature visually for major themes and topics. Reference Manager 11 helps users locate full text faster by connecting to an institution's online resources using OpenURL standards. Source: Thomson ISI ResearchSoft
